On Thu, Aug 08, 2019 at 09:07:53AM +0530, Rayagonda Kokatanur wrote: > From: Lori Hikichi <lori.hikichi@broadcom.com> > > Add the full name of the devicetree node to the adapter name. > Without this change, all adapters have the same name making it difficult > to distinguish between multiple instances. > The most obvious way to see this is to use the utility i2c_detect. > e.g. "i2c-detect -l" > > Before > i2c-1 i2c Broadcom iProc I2C adapter I2C adapter > i2c-0 i2c Broadcom iProc I2C adapter I2C adapter > > After > i2c-1 i2c Broadcom iProc (i2c@e0000) I2C adapter > i2c-0 i2c Broadcom iProc (i2c@b0000) I2C adapter > > Now it is easy to figure out which adapter maps to a which DT node. > > Signed-off-by: Lori Hikichi <lori.hikichi@broadcom.com> > Signed-off-by: Rayagonda Kokatanur <rayagonda.kokatanur@broadcom.com>
